Output 89e9904bc7070f91f4144338f309754e7b2a6dd41d5cb1872959b0be4ba70c2e:0

value
596268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4dfe3fbb3e64b8e42349fb8777dc4b171ef6bef OP_EQUAL
address
3NZCCUCvHL9CuWCDYKD7vUidmaCCJHiy2o
transaction
89e9904bc7070f91f4144338f309754e7b2a6dd41d5cb1872959b0be4ba70c2e
confirmations
285982
spent
true